علمی
2 دقیقه پیش | رزرو بلیط هواپیما مشهدسفر به مشهد از آن دست سفرهاییست که قرنها از عمر محبوبیتاش میگذرد و زائران امام هشتم شیعیان، خود را به وسیلههای مختلف به این شهر میرساندند. خوشبختانه ... |
2 دقیقه پیش | دوره مدیریت پروژه و کنترل پروژه با MSPپروژه چیست؟ پروژه به مجموعه ای از فعالیتها اطلاق می شود که برای رسیدن به هدف خاصی مانند ساختن یک برج، تاسیس یک بزرگراه، تولید یک نرم افزار و … انجام می شود. در همه پروژه ... |
روباتی که به کودکان کدنویسی آموزش میدهد
تک شات/ آموزش کدنویسی به کودکان ایده بسیار جالبی است که اغلب موارد به تلاش زیادی نیاز دارد و نمی توان به آسانی ذهن کودکان را برای برنامه نویسی آماده کرد. اکنون تیمی از محققان هاروارد روبات کوچکی را طراحی کردهاند که Root نام دارد و به منظور ملموس کردن فرآیند کدنویسی برای کودکان طراحی شده است.
تیمی از موسسه Wyss هاروارد از سه سال پیش مشغول کار روی این پروژه بودهاند. این تیم مدعی شده است که این روبات کوچک شش ضلعی به منظور آموزش به یک کودک 5 ساله تا یک برنامه نویس حد متوسط طراحی شده است.
این ربات همه کار است و به کاربر امکان میدهد تا آن را با آیکونهای گرافیکی، یک زبان ساده مانند MIT Scratch یا حتی یک کد پیشرفته همچون JavaScript برنامه ریزی کند.
به گفته Raphael Cheney، یکی از کارشناسان این موسسه، در حال حاضر برنامه نویسی بسیار خشک است و تنها با استفاه از کیبورد کامپیوتر آموزش داده میشود. این فرآیند هیچ تعاملی با دنیای واقعی ندارد و این موضوع مانع از جذب شدن کودکان خواهد شد. ربات جدید Root کدنویسی را به روشی سرگرم کننده و قابل دسترس به دنیای واقعی میآورد. به این ترتیب کودکانی که هیچ سابقهای در کدنویسی ندارند میتوانند در کمتر از چند دقیقه رباتها را برنامه ریزی کنند.
این ربات جدید به سخت افزاری مجهز شده است که به فردی که آن را کنترل میکند امکان میدهد تا اوقات خوشی را سپری کند. کودکان میتوانند این ربات را با استفاده از یک رابط کاربری در تبلت خود به نام Square برنامه ریزی کنند. این ربات دارای سنسورهای جهت یاب، رنگ و نور است و به ضربه گیر و سطح لمسی مجهز شده است تا بتواند نسبت به دنیای واقعی واکنش نشان دهد. این ربات هم چنین دارای پنلهای مغناطیسی است و به این ترتیب میتواند روی دیوارهای فلزی عمودی و تختههای وایت بورد حرکت کند. این ربات هم چنین میتواند با استفاده از خودکاری که در قسمت پایینی آن تعبیه شده است، روی سطح زیرین خود طرحهای مورد نظر کاربر را ترسیم کند.
منبع:
ویدیو مرتبط :
روباتی برای آموزش برنامه نویسی به کودکان